Thome's tape-measure home run
By Mark Gonzales, 8:29 p.m.http://blogs.chicagosports.chicagotribune.com/sports_hardball/2008/06/thomes-tape-mea.htmlWhite Sox designated hitter Jim Thome launched a 464-foot home run in the fourth inning off Kansas City’s Luke Hochevar.
Thome’s deep blast to center field was the ninth longest home run in U.S. Cellular Field history. Thome’s homer was a two-run shot that tied the game at 2-2 and was the 518th of his career.
